Ingredients

The foundation of this dish is plain Greek yogurt, which provides a thick canvas for the chocolate glaze. Dark chocolate gives depth and a slight bitterness that balances the natural tang of the yogurt. Fresh mint leaves add a bright, herbaceous pop, while a drizzle of honey introduces just enough sweetness to round out the flavors. A splash of vanilla and a pinch of sea salt elevate the overall profile, creating a harmonious blend of sweet, salty, and minty notes.

Yogurt Base

  • 2 cups plain Greek yogurt (full‑fat)
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• ½ te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• Pinch of sea salt

Minty Chocolate Glaze

  • 100 g dark chocolate (70 % cacao)
  • 2 tablespoons he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on finely chopped fresh mint leaves
  • 1 teaspoon honey (optional for extra sweetness)

Garnish (Optional)

  • Fresh mint sprigs for decoration
  • Shaved dark chocolate curls

Together, these ingredients create a layered experience: the yogurt provides a cool, creamy bite; the chocolate glaze adds a glossy, slightly bitter sheen; and the mint injects a refreshing lift that cuts through richness. The optional garnish not only adds visual flair but also introduces a textural contrast that makes each wedge feel luxurious.

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paring the Yogurt Base

In a medium bowl, whisk together Greek yogurt, honey, vanilla extract, and a pinch of sea salt until smooth. The honey not only sweetens but also helps the yogurt set more firmly once chilled. Transfer the mixture to a shallow, square baking dish (about 8×8 in) and smooth the top with a spatula.

Making the Minty Chocolate Glaze

Place dark chocolate and heavy cream in a heat‑proof bowl. Melt over a simmering pot of water (double boiler) or in short bursts in the microwave, stirring every 20 seconds. Once smooth, stir in the chopped mint and optional honey. The mint should be finely minced so its flavor distributes evenly without leaving large leaf pieces.

Assembling & Chilling

  1. Cool the Yogurt. Cover the dish with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 45‑60 minutes, or until the yogurt is firm enough to cut cleanly. This step is crucial for clean wedges.
  2. Slice the Wedges. Using a sharp knife, cut the set yogurt into even squares or triangles—aim for 1‑inch thick pieces. A gentle hand prevents crumbling.
  3. Drizzle the Glaze. Arrange the yogurt wedges on a serving platter. Using a spoon or a small ladle, drizzle the warm mint‑chocolate glaze over each wedge, allowing it to pool slightly at the base.
  4. Garnish. Sprinkle shaved chocolate curls and place a tiny mint sprig on each wedge for a pop of color and aroma.
  5. Final Chill. Return the platter to the fridge for another 10‑15 minutes so the glaze sets lightly. Serve chilled for the best texture contrast.

Tips & Tricks

Perfecting the Recipe

Use Full‑Fat Yogurt: The higher fat content helps the base hold its shape and adds a richer mouthfeel.

Chill the Glaze Slightly: Let the melted chocolate sit for 2‑3 minutes before drizzling; it will thicken just enough to coat without running off.

Fine‑Chop Mint: A micro‑chopper or mortar and pestle releases essential oils without leaving leafy bits.

Sharp Knife for Cutting: Warm the blade under hot water, dry, then slice—this prevents the yogurt from sticking.

Flavor Enhancements

Add a splash of orange zest to the glaze for citrus brightness, or stir in a pinch of sea‑salt flakes just before serving to accentuate the chocolate’s depth.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oid over‑melting the chocolate; high heat can cause a grainy texture. Also, don’t skip the chilling step for the yogurt—soft yogurt will crumble and lose its wedge shape.

Pro Tips

Layer Flavors Early: Mix a tiny amount of mint directly into the yogurt before setting for an extra subtle herb note throughout.

Use a Silicone Brush: For an even glaze, brush the chocolate over each wedge rather than pouring, which gives a smoother finish.

Serve Immediately After Final Chill: The glaze can soften at room temperature, so enjoy within an hour for optimal texture.

Variations

Ingredient Swaps

Swap Greek yogurt for coconut‑based yogurt to make the dish dairy‑free, or replace dark chocolate with white chocolate for a sweeter, creamier glaze. Fresh basil can stand in for mint if you prefer an herbaceous twist.

Dietary Adjustments

For a low‑sugar version, use a sugar‑free sweetener like erythritol in place of honey. To keep it keto, choose a chocolate with at least 85 % cacao and skip the honey entirely, adding a few drops of liquid stevia instead.

Serving Suggestions

Pair the wedges with a cup of freshly brewed coffee or a sparkling mint‑infused water. For a brunch spread, add a mixed berry compote on the side to introduce a tart contrast that brightens the palate.

Storage Info

Leftover Storage

Allow any leftovers to come to room temperature, then transfer the wedges and any remaining glaze into separate airtight containers. Store the yogurt wedges in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The glaze can be kept in a small jar, also refrigerated, for up to a week.

Reheating Instructions

These wedges are best enjoyed cold, but if you prefer a warm treat, gently warm the glaze in a saucepan over low heat, then drizzle over the chilled yogurt. Avoid microwaving the yogurt itself, as it can become grainy.
